![]() ![]() But when he finds one of Naina’s library books and remembers her love of reading, he decides to venture out to the neighborhood library, setting in motion an adventure that gives him a new purpose in life and connects him with the troubled librarian, Aleisha, along with several other library patrons.Īleisha has just discovered a reading list of eight books tucked into the back of one of the library books she was putting away. His grown daughters are hovering over him and treating him like a child. ![]() He is lonely and tends to be reclusive, unlike his warm, outgoing wife Naina. Each chapter featured the perspective of a single character, and they used several narrators to give voice to the very different characters in the book.Įlderly widower Mukesh Patel is not thriving after his wife’s death from cancer. I read the print book, but I can imagine it would be wonderful on Audible. ![]() The author’s parents are Indian and English, so she renders the Indian characters and the London setting beautifully. Published in 2021, this book was a lovely, heartwarming story that all book lovers will enjoy and appreciate-an outstanding debut novel. Review of The Reading List by Sara Nisha Adams ![]()
